BTW, I wonder how an RFE looks like. We got an Action of Notice exactly on our 4th month of waiting and asking for my fiance's first divorce decree, but he didn't see it's an RFE. He didn't also get a notification email or text messages saying an RFE will be coming by mail. Neither the USCIS website says we're still on initial review.

I dunno our current position as of the moment.

It doesn't say RFE on the form, it is a Notification, so you got an Request For Evidence about a divorce decree. I am expecting one also as I sent an old copy I had on file, have since requested a new certified copy so that I am ready for the RFE.
